#4 – Martin Kleppmann: CRDTs, Automerge, generic syncing servers & Bluesky
Description
The guest of this episode, Martin Kleppmann, is one of the authors of the original local-first essay. Martin has been exploring local-first software and CRDTs for over 10 years, which has led to the creation of Automerge, which we discuss in depth in this episode. This episode is also exploring the ideas of generic sync servers and the impact this technology could have on local-first software in the future.
Mentioned in podcast
Martin Kleppmann: martin.kleppmann.com + x.com/martinkl + bsky.app/profile/martin.kleppmann.com + nondeterministic.computer/@martinInk & SwitchBlueskyAutomerge CRDTsThe original CRDT paperOur JSON CRDT paperOur design for rich text in AutomergeHow Bluesky works
Links:
Website: localfirst.fmX/Twitter: x.com/localfirstfmYouTube: youtube.com/@localfirstfmLocal-First Conf 2024Thank you to Expo and CrabNebula for supporting the podcast.
The guest of this episode is James Arthur, founder and CEO of Electric SQL, a Postgres-centric sync engine for local-first apps. This conversation will dive deep into how Electric works and explore its design decisions such as read-path syncing and using HTTP as the network layer to improve...
Published 12/03/24
The guest of this episode is Kyle Simpson, a prolific JavaScript engineer and author of the book You Don’t Know JS. Over the past years, Kyle has been researching user identity and encryption in a local-first context which we explore in depth in this episode. This conversation will dive into the...
Published 11/12/24